TV On The Radio released the lush and beautiful album, Nine Types of Light, which Esquire says it’s “The best album so far of 2011.” TV On The Radioburst onto the scene in 2001, with their 18-track demo tape OK Calculator, which they hid in the couch cushions of coffee shops throughout New York City.  From there the band released three more studio albums to critical acclaim and outward praise, often finding themselves atop “Best of” lists from Rolling Stone, Spin Magazine, The Onion AV Club, MTV and Entertainment Weekly’s as well as  Pitchfork Media's readers poll and the Pazz and Jop critic's poll.

On September 27th Duran Duran will take over Club Nokia as they bring their North American Fall tour to LA. This is the band’s first extensive North American tour behind their new album ALL YOU NEED IS NOW, following a brief run of brilliantly reviewed intimate album release shows earlier this year. With a brand new production that the band has designed specifically for this tour, Duran Duran will play their biggest hits and the incredible new songs that have inspired many to declare that the band is truly having a big moment in 2011.  One of the most celebrated albums of the band’s storied three-decade career, the nine-track digital-only version of ALL YOU NEED IS NOW hit #1 on the iTunes Albums Charts in 15 countries before the release of the 14-track LP earlier this year. Duran Duran have sold more than 80 million albums throughout their career.

BLONDIE * October 5th @ Club Nokia
Blondie will play Club Nokia on October 5th as part of their North American Fall tour behind their 9th critically acclaimed album Panic of Girls, available now digitally and physically exclusively via Amazon here<http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/B005E7AOSC/ref=s9_simh_gw_p15_d12_g15_i1?pf_rd_m=ATVPDKIKX0DER&pf_rd_s=center-2&pf_rd_r=0GT9W3FB2AQ2W89KN070&pf_rd_t=101&pf_rd_p=470938631&pf_rd_i=507846>. With  a sound more recognizable than ever, Debbie Harry, Clem Burke and Chris Stein, along with newer band members Leigh Foxx, Tommy Kessler and Matt Katz-Bohen, are bringing their impressive new collection of songs and Blondie hits to crowds across the country. The band had a whirlwind release week that included a performance of single “Mother” on TODAY<http://today.msnbc.msn.com/id/36606816/vp/44486925/#44486925>, glowing reviews, two sold out NYC shows and a pop-up shop at Marc Jacobs. Admist the tour, Blondie will perform on The Tonight Show with Jay Leno on October 6th.

Panic of Girls - colored with inspirations from NYC’s melting pot and street-level pop culture – has received praise from the likes of the New York Times, Harper’s Bazaar, USA Today, Elle, Marie Claire, Entertainment Weekly, People and New York Post. Blondie was inducted into the Rock 'N' Roll Hall of Fame in 2006 and has sold more than 40 million albums worldwide.
